    Manchester City manager Pep Guardiola has hailed midfielder Kevin de Bruyne as one of the greatest players in Premier League football history, after the club captain's announcement he'd be leaving at the end of the season


    The 33-year-old Belgian has won 16 trophies with City, including six Premier League titles and a Champions League triumph.

    Guardiola paid tribute to de Bruyne's contributions at the club.
